Real Madrid set €150m price for Vinícius Júnior as Arsenal circle
0
Real Madrid are prepared to sell Vinícius Júnior for around €150 million if contract talks break down, according to ESPN.
The Brazilian winger's future has been one of the big talking points at the Bernabéu, and the next few days look decisive. Sources say a key round of negotiations between Madrid officials and Vinícius's camp is scheduled for this week, with the club having improved its offer to around €22 million per year. That, however, is described as Real's final proposal.
Vinícius, whose current deal runs until the summer of 2027, is holding out for close to €30 million a season. That gap in expectations is why the two sides have yet to reach an agreement.
Real's stance is clear: they do not want to run the risk of letting him enter the final year of his contract without a resolution. If no deal is reached, they will listen to offers, but only for a fee in the region of €150 million.
Arsenal continue to show genuine interest in the Brazilian, although no formal bid has been made. Still, both parties remain hopeful that a compromise can be found and that a departure will not be necessary.
